Episode Description

If we are to truly create inclusive and welcoming environments, it is important that people are comfortable to be themselves and know they are appreciated and respected. It is for this reason that we say it is necessary to celebrate, not tolerate diversity. In this episode, Dale and Lisa will discuss the approach to celebrating diversity, the role it plays in creating equitable dynamics between people and the need to communicate your support and celebration of diversity.  Good practice examples from Connecting the Pieces resourceBuilding Culturally Inclusive Social Support Groups and the Centre for Cultural Diversity in Ageing are shared to help listeners support the implementation of inclusive practice.
